Harbhajan Singh Top 5 Best Test Cricketer: Former Indian off-spinner Harbhajan Singh has selected his favorite five best Test cricketers. Bhajji has not included the names of players like Virat Kohli, Joe Root and Ravichandran Ashwin in this list. Due to this, the fans are trolling him fiercely.
Quoting Cricketwallah’s tweet, Harbhajan wrote the names of his five favorite cricketers on Twitter. However, in this, he also made a wrong spelling in writing some names, due to which he has come under the target of the fans. Due to this mistake of his, the fans are trolling him fiercely.

Harbhajan Singh has selected Australia’s Steve Smith, Nathan Lyon, England’s Ben Stokes and India’s Ravindra Jadeja and Rishabh Pant among his favorite five best Test cricketers. Please tell that Pant has been India’s most successful batsman in Test cricket in the last two years. That Jadeja is currently the best all-rounder in the world. Apart from this, Steve Smith is playing for Australia in Ashes 2023. He is the second best batsman in Test cricket and just one step away from becoming number one.
Harbhajan, who recently celebrated his 43rd birthday, said goodbye to cricket in the year 2021. Bhajji played his last match in IPL 2021. At the same time, he last played for India in the year 2016. Bhajji has played a total of 103 Test matches, 236 ODIs and 28 T20 Internationals for India. Now he is also a Rajya Sabha MP from the Aam Aadmi Party. Apart from this, he also does commentary.
